Canal+ and Kudelski shut down KBoxServ

French audiovisual media group Canal+ Group and digital security specialist the Kudelski Group have confirmed the shutdown of a piracy organisation based in Canton of Vaud (Lake Geneva region), that delivered French-speaking on-demand content to thousands of customers. It is the first piracy shutdown of its kind in Switzerland. The operation is the result of […]

Intelsat/Telenor lose Canal+ business

With SES taking a larger slice of Canal+ capacity requirements, it is inevitable that there had to be a loser. That satellite operator is the Intelsat/Telenor position at 1-degree West. Canal+ owned-M7 group will consolidate its Eastern European coverage on SES at 23.5 degrees East cutting out Intelsat/Telenor at 1 West. SES is thus gaining […]

Canal+ owns 12% of Multichoice

Groupe Canal+ has confirmed that it has crossed the 10 per cent threshold in share capital of MultiChoice Group. As of October 28th, Groupe Canal+ owns 12 per cent of the company’s share capital. Earlier this month, Canal+ acquired a 6.5 per cent stake in the South Africa-based pay-TV provider. Canal+ said at the time […]
